MORRISVILLE, N.C. — A man who had just arrived at Raleigh-Durham International Airport drove off N.C. Highway 54 and into some trees overnight Sunday, Raleigh police said.

The man was driving south on Airport Boulevard, which ends at an intersection with N.C. 54/Chapel Hill Road, police said. The man drove across N.C. 54 and into some trees on the other side. He was pinned in the vehicle.

Rescuers extricated him and transported him to Duke Hospital. There was no word on the extent of his injuries.

The man, who flew in from Alabama, is new to the area and missed the traffic lights at the intersection, police said.
